North Memorial Homes & Framework Knitters Cottages Conservation Area
North Memorial Homes & Framework Knitters Cottages is a small conservation area in England, covering approximately 3.6 hectares of protected landscape. It is designated in 1988, reflecting the area's longstanding cultural and architectural significance.
At 3.6 hectares, this is a compact conservation area — smaller than the UK average of around 45 hectares.

- What restrictions apply in North Memorial Homes & Framework Knitters Cottages?
- Properties in North Memorial Homes & Framework Knitters Cottages Conservation Area may face restrictions on demolition, tree work (6 weeks' notice required), and certain exterior alterations. Contact your local planning authority for specific rules that apply here.
